Twenty six years ago on this day, Carol Hess founded Medical Claim Service to assist those who were confused and frustrated with their medical paperwork. Through this period, Medical Claim Service has helped hundreds of clients sort through the maze of insurance and medical papers assisting clients with understanding insurance terms, informing them of what bills to pay and explain insurance benefits. Medical Claim Service has also branched out to assist many clients with their monthly bill pay by sorting through all the mail, writing checks, balancing accounts and providing account reports as needed.

Medicare Part A Changes for 2012
Medicare has announced the changes to deductible and coinsurances for Medicare Part a. Medicare Part A covers facility type charges such as inpatient hospital stays and skilled care in a skilled nursing facility.
The inpatient hospital deductible will increase to $1,156 in 2012, an increase of $24 from 2011. It important to understand that the Part A deductible is NOT an annual deductible. Medicare uses a period of 60 days to determine patient responsibility; therefore a patient could be responsible for this deductible more than once in a year.
The skilled nursing facility coinsurance also increases in 2012 to $144.50 per day for days 21 ? 100; the 2011 amount was $141.50 per day. For days 0 ? 20, Medicare pays for services at 100%.
